Getting Paid (and Paying) in Crypto

Freelancers, remote workers, and even small businesses are increasingly turning to crypto for payments,  not to get rich, but to get paid faster and cheaper. Platforms like Deel and Bitwage make it easy to send crypto salaries globally, bypassing high bank fees and long transfer delays.

A designer in the Philippines can now work for a startup in Berlin and get paid in USDC within minutes. On the other side, employers use crypto to simplify payroll and avoid unnecessary FX conversion costs.

It’s fast. It’s borderless. It’s no longer a niche option, it’s becoming the default for many digital workers.

2. Playing and Earning on Crypto Gaming Platforms

Crypto gaming isn’t just about speculative NFTs anymore. In 2025, people are logging into fully functional blockchain-based games where they play, earn, and own their in-game assets. And most importantly, these games are finally fun.

Web3 titles are attracting regular gamers who enjoy the gameplay first and then realise the perks of owning items or earning tokens that hold value. From trading skins to earning rewards in native tokens, these platforms are becoming mini-economies of their own.

Platforms like Axie Infinity may have paved the way, but newer games are learning from past mistakes and offering more balanced, long-term gameplay models.

3. Spending Crypto on Daily Purchases

Crypto debit cards are now mainstream,  think of them like your Visa or Mastercard, but topped up with crypto. Services like Crypto.com and Binance Card allow users to pay for groceries, coffee, or even a taxi with USDT or BTC.

Even more interesting, some people are using stablecoins like USDC and DAI to manage their budgets, sidestepping inflation in their local currencies. In countries like Argentina or Turkey, saving in stablecoins is safer than keeping cash in the bank.

For many, crypto isn’t an investment,  it’s a digital dollar that holds its value better than their actual currency.

4. Accessing Financial Services Without Banks

Decentralised Finance (DeFi) still sounds scary to the average person, but in practice, it’s becoming more user-friendly. Apps like Aave, Compound, and newer mobile-first platforms now offer:

  • Saving accounts (earn 4-7% APY)
  • Loans (collateralised or uncollateralised with credit scores)
  • Swapping between currencies instantly

This is especially powerful in regions with limited banking infrastructure. If you have internet access and a phone, you have a bank, and in some cases, a better one.

No paperwork. No middlemen. Just a wallet and a connection.

6. Donating and Supporting Causes

More people are donating in crypto than ever before, not because they want tax deductions (although those help), but because it’s fast, borderless, and reaches people directly.

Whether it’s sending ETH to a Ukrainian family or supporting a local community in Kenya, platforms like The Giving Block and Endaoment make it easier than ever to fund causes around the world.

Even NGOs and charities are adopting stablecoins to reduce overheads and speed up relief efforts.

7. Managing Wealth Across Generations

Crypto is no longer just for the young and tech-savvy. Families and older generations are setting up crypto wills and trusts to pass on wealth, often in the form of Bitcoin or stablecoins.

Custodial solutions and wallet recovery tools have improved dramatically in the past couple of years, reducing the “what if I lose my keys?” anxiety.

As real estate tokenisation becomes more accessible, people are even investing in fractional property ownership using their crypto. It’s long-term thinking with global flexibility.

8. Saving on Remittance Fees

This has been a use case for years, but in 2025, it’s even stronger. Instead of paying 6-10% in traditional remittance fees, people are sending stablecoins to family across borders for less than a dollar.

Apps like Strike and Bitnob now integrate directly with messaging platforms or bank APIs, making crypto remittances feel as simple as sending a WhatsApp message.For many, this is life-changing. It means more money reaches home, instantly.

9. Earning Passive Income

Through staking, lending, or participating in liquidity pools, many crypto users now earn passive income, but unlike in the past, they’re doing it with less risk. Platforms are more transparent, audits are more common, and users are wiser.

People are diversifying, understanding risks, and building monthly side income that actually adds value.
